Game Update: Sounds and color


I am still working on OutOfScope about once a week so progress is a little slow but still interesting to me. The latest update introduces audio and particle color blending which are prototypes for two of my three milestones.

A bell will play whenever particles bounce off the green bouncers. I plan to expand this by having each level play sounds repeatedly to gradually form a soundtrack. Playing around with sound is fun although I also see it become a little noisy in the long run.

If red and blue particles collide they become purple and any particle that hit a purple particle becomes purple. The goal only consumes particles of a matching color. Since the levels only has red goals now, mixing colors does not help solving the puzzles. I expect to have some levels where initially colors will be mixing and make it possible to avoid this by redirecting the particles around each other.
